Can connect to XBMC via IP address but not hostname - peachtree14 - 2013-01-17 I have two XBMC installations, one on a XP laptop and another on a Win7 desktop. I have the official remote installed on both an Android phone as well as an Ipad. For both of these I can connect fine to either instance of XBMC if I specify the IP address, however not if I specify the hostname. This is annoying in that my IP addresses are not fixed, so I have to check them every time I want to use the remote. I'm not sure if I'm specifying the hostname incorrectly, I've tried the following: bluefly BLUEFLY Bluefly \\bluefly etc but none made any difference. If I do a "ping bluefly" from command line it replies fine. I have come across a similar thread on the forum but there was no solution posted. Any ideas? |
